Waffle Recipe Vegetarian: Easy, Delicious Meat-Free Ideas

Updated On: October 4, 2025

Waffles are a beloved breakfast staple that bring comfort and delight to any morning table. Whether you’re planning a leisurely weekend brunch or a quick weekday treat, this vegetarian waffle recipe is a perfect choice.

Made with wholesome ingredients and free from any animal products, these waffles are fluffy, tender, and irresistibly golden. The best part?

They’re incredibly easy to make and versatile enough to pair with a variety of toppings, from fresh fruit to nut butters or even savory avocado spreads.

In this recipe, you’ll find simple pantry staples and a straightforward method that yields perfect results every time. Plus, this vegetarian waffle recipe offers a healthy twist without sacrificing flavor or texture.

If you’ve been searching for a delicious way to enjoy waffles that fit your vegetarian lifestyle, you’re in the right place!

Why You’ll Love This Recipe

This vegetarian waffle recipe is a game-changer for several reasons. First, it’s incredibly simple to prepare, requiring just one bowl and minimal ingredients.

You don’t need any eggs or dairy, making it suitable for many dietary preferences and easy to whip up at a moment’s notice.

Second, these waffles come out with a perfect balance of crispy edges and a soft, fluffy interior, which is exactly what you want in a great waffle. The use of plant-based milk and a touch of vegetable oil ensures moistness without heaviness.

Lastly, the recipe is highly adaptable. You can customize it by adding your favorite spices, fruits, or even shredded vegetables.

It’s a wonderful base recipe that opens the door to exciting flavor variations while keeping things vegetarian and wholesome.

Ingredients

  • 1 ½ cups all-purpose flour
  • 2 tablespoons sugar (adjust to taste)
  • 1 tablespoon baking powder
  • ½ teaspoon salt
  • 1 ¼ cups plant-based milk (such as almond, soy, or oat milk)
  • 3 tablespoons vegetable oil (or melted coconut oil)
  • 1 teaspoon vanilla extract
  • Optional: ½ teaspoon ground cinnamon for added warmth and flavor

Equipment

  • Waffle iron or waffle maker
  • Large mixing bowl
  • Whisk or fork
  • Measuring cups and spoons
  • Spatula (for removing waffles)
  • Cooling rack (optional, helps keep waffles crisp)

Instructions

  1. Preheat your waffle iron. Plug it in and let it heat up while you prepare the batter.
  2. Mix dry ingredients. In a large mixing bowl, whisk together the all-purpose flour, sugar, baking powder, salt, and optional cinnamon until evenly combined.
  3. Combine wet ingredients. In a separate bowl or measuring cup, mix the plant-based milk, vegetable oil, and vanilla extract.
  4. Make the batter. Pour the wet ingredients into the dry ingredients. Stir gently with a whisk or fork until just combined. Be careful not to overmix — some lumps are okay!
  5. Grease the waffle iron. Lightly brush or spray the waffle iron with oil to prevent sticking.
  6. Cook the waffles. Pour enough batter onto the waffle iron to cover the surface but not overflow. Close the lid and cook according to your waffle maker’s instructions, usually 3-5 minutes, until waffles are golden brown and crisp.
  7. Remove and keep warm. Use a spatula to carefully lift out the waffle. Place on a cooling rack to keep crisp while you cook the remaining batter.
  8. Serve immediately. Enjoy warm with your favorite toppings.

Tips & Variations

“For extra fluffy waffles, sift your flour and baking powder together before mixing. This helps incorporate air and ensures a lighter texture.”

  • Add mix-ins: Fold in fresh blueberries, chopped nuts, or vegan chocolate chips for a twist.
  • Try savory waffles: Add chopped herbs like chives or parsley, or fold in shredded zucchini or carrot for a veggie-packed breakfast.
  • Use gluten-free flour: Substitute with a 1:1 gluten-free baking flour blend to make these waffles gluten-free.
  • Swap the oil: Use melted coconut oil or vegan butter for a richer flavor.
  • Make it vegan-friendly: This recipe is naturally vegan, but always double-check your plant-based milk and oil choices if you’re strictly vegan.

Nutrition Facts

Nutrient Amount per Waffle
Calories 180 kcal
Carbohydrates 28 g
Protein 4 g
Fat 6 g
Saturated Fat 1 g
Sodium 300 mg
Fiber 1 g
Sugar 5 g

Serving Suggestions

These vegetarian waffles are incredibly versatile and can be served in numerous delightful ways. For a classic breakfast, top them with fresh berries, a drizzle of maple syrup, and a sprinkle of powdered sugar.

If you prefer something savory, try topping with smashed avocado, cherry tomatoes, and a pinch of chili flakes for a delicious brunch option. Alternatively, create a dessert waffle by adding vegan whipped cream and sliced bananas or vegan chocolate sauce.

For a protein boost, pair the waffles with a side of sautéed mushrooms or a warming bowl of vegetarian chili — check out our Chili Recipe Slow Cooker Vegetarian: Easy & Hearty Meal for inspiration.

Conclusion

Whether you’re a longtime vegetarian or simply looking to incorporate more plant-based meals into your diet, this vegetarian waffle recipe is a must-try. It combines simplicity, healthfulness, and deliciousness in every bite.

The recipe’s adaptable nature means you can enjoy it in many different ways, making it a versatile staple for your kitchen.

With easy-to-find ingredients and minimal prep time, these waffles are perfect for busy mornings or relaxed weekend brunches. Don’t hesitate to experiment with your favorite add-ins and toppings to make the recipe truly your own.

For more vegetarian inspiration, be sure to explore our Vegetarian Swiss Chard Recipes for Healthy Meals and Vegetarian Tex Mex Recipes for Easy Weeknight Dinners.

Happy cooking and enjoy your delicious vegetarian waffles!

📖 Recipe Card: Vegetarian Waffle Recipe

Description: Delicious and fluffy vegetarian waffles perfect for breakfast or brunch. Easy to prepare with simple ingredients.

Prep Time: PT10M
Cook Time: PT15M
Total Time: PT25M

Servings: 4 servings

Ingredients

  • 2 cups all-purpose flour
  • 2 tablespoons sugar
  • 1 tablespoon baking powder
  • 1/2 teaspoon salt
  • 2 large eggs
  • 1 3/4 cups milk
  • 1/2 cup vegetable oil
  • 1 teaspoon vanilla extract
  • Optional: fresh berries or maple syrup for serving

Instructions

  1. Preheat waffle iron.
  2. In a large bowl, mix flour, sugar, baking powder, and salt.
  3. In another bowl, whisk eggs, milk, oil, and vanilla extract.
  4. Combine wet and dry ingredients; stir until just mixed.
  5. Pour batter into waffle iron and cook until golden brown.
  6. Serve warm with fresh berries or maple syrup if desired.

Nutrition: Calories: 350 kcal | Protein: 8 g | Fat: 14 g | Carbs: 45 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Vegetarian Waffle Recipe”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“Delicious and fluffy vegetarian waffles perfect for breakfast or brunch. Easy to prepare with simple ingredients.”, “prepTime”: “PT10M”, “cookTime”: “PT15M”, “totalTime”: “PT25M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“2 cups all-purpose flour”, “2 tablespoons sugar”, “1 tablespoon baking powder”, “1/2 teaspoon salt”, “2 large eggs”, “1 3/4 cups milk”, “1/2 cup vegetable oil”, “1 teaspoon vanilla extract”, “Optional: fresh berries or maple syrup for serving”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at waffle iron.”}, {“@type”: “HowToStep”, “text”: “In a large bowl, mix flour, sugar, baking powder, and salt.”}, {“@type”: “HowToStep”, “text”: “In another bowl, whisk eggs, milk, oil, and vanilla extract.”}, {“@type”: “HowToStep”, “text”: “Combine wet and dry ingredients; stir until just mixed.”}, {“@type”: “HowToStep”, “text”: “Pour batter into waffle iron and cook until golden brown.”}, {“@type”: “HowToStep”, “text”: “Serve warm with fresh berries or maple syrup if desired.”}], “nutrition”: {“calories”: “350 kcal”, “proteinContent”: “8 g”, “fatContent”: “14 g”, “carbohydrateContent”: “45 g”}}

Photo of author

Marta K

Leave a Comment

X